Washington Sept 6 : Since the time the news of 17-year-old Bristol Plain's pregnancy broke, it seems every star and starlet has a different opinion of John McCain's running mate, Sarah Palin, and whether her daughter will affect their campaign.
One of the top celebrities, Eva Mendes has also given her comments on the hot topic.
"It's never easy when you're dealing with something like teen pregnancy," Fox News quoted Eva Mendes, as saying at "The Women" premiere in Los Angeles.
"People need to look beyond that and give her [Sarah] the chance to have her fair say," she added.
The very vocal supporter of John McCain, the 'Hills' star Heidi Montag ept pretty quiet about the Palin controversy.
"I just wish them all the best of luck," she told Pop Tarts, with beau, Spencer Pratt (of course), nodding in agreement.
Fellow reality star Kim Kardashian didn't feel comfortable commenting on the controversy.
